Main Activity

Explain and play the Double or halve? game with your student.

PLAY - Double or halve? problem (Maths.org)

It may take a few times playing the game for your student to get used to the rules and what they can and can’t do.

Encourage your student to be resilient with the game, to not give up, and to persevere with seeing it through to the end.

Encourage your student to play the game several times with you, so that they see there is more than one way of winning.

Ask questions throughout the game such as:

  • How do you know?
  • Can you use your doubling skills?
  • Can you use your halving skills?
